3 On Linux, PowerShell scripts are supported, from Windows computers targeting SQL Server on Linux. There are five editions of SQL Server: Express: This is the most basic of all SQL Server editions. Darwin for general unrelated questions, head to a Q&A site like https://dba.stackexchange.com or https://sqlservercentral.com. Agreed with Jeff there, and hope isnt a strategy: we gotta test before we go live. Data safety is a major highlight of this version. Cheers! microsoft sql server 2016 end of life For this activity, you'll need a number chart 1 - 20 and the numbers 1 to 20 with some colorful thumbtacks. 3. Wanna see Erik Darling as Freddie Mercury at #SQLbits? I define a modern version of SQL Server as SQL Server 2016 or later. How are you going to use Power BI? No much to gain but can upgrade by changing the compat mode. June 15, 2017 Page 2 of 3 (5) Retirement Services will calculate the difference in employee and employer contribution rates from Tier 1 to Tier 2 from date of hire to .But if it chose the 6.5% target, the risk of hitting that potential death spiral was reduced to 15%, but the contribution rates for local governments would be higher. This version can comfortably support Python scripting language, which is in addition to Al a new must-have feature in IT. Enhanced spinlock algorithms. Maximum capacity specifications for SQL Server. I was going to consider 2019 and just go for it. Now in Power Query, you need to call the function with the menu Add Column > Invoke Custom Function. Next year the only really supported version will be SQL 2019 (extended support is only for Security fixes). Mark go through the list of concerns on 2019, and think about which ones happen regardless of compatibility level. Does that mean that you can update table data, but the columnstore index returns the old data? Cores (processors) Except for Enterprise, you can only get Core licenses. We have now 11 CUs for 2019 and almost 2 years sice its release. On Standard edition there is support for two nodes. Moving on. I have similar problems but Im scared to death of all the nasty things Ive heard of in 2019. The SQL you are looking for is below: SELECT SubscriberKey , Birthdate ,. 2019? While Im on, what was that about nonclustered columnstore indexes being not updatable previously? Easily upgrade to the Enterprise edition without changing any code. As such, the 2019 version is the best. You can now witness the execution plan of a query active on the system, unlike in the past where you had to view only the estimated execution plan. All of their latest versions are just a fancy wordings. SQL Server 2017 (with the big milestone of SQL on Linux) SQL Server 2019. exe on 64-bit operating system. Same goes with progress reports. Nope. Third, the 2016 version could also be installed using command prompt, but . The best that someone can do on prem is state how long the last restore took and provide an estimate that it would take that long again with no guarantee that it wont take longer because of something unexpected happening. Replied on July 1, 2017 Not possible, you need to check the developers website then download the 32 bit version of the software you need to install. The obvious answer is 2019 but thats not out yet. Answers to those questions have stopped some of my clients from adopting Azure SQL DB. Two things Id like to point out: Hello, I had the feeling that you do not recommend it at all, but it seems I am not entirely right after I read carefully:) MDS can be configured to manage any domain (products, customers, accounts) and includes hierarchies, granular security, transactions, data versioning, and business rules, as well as an Add-in for Excel that can be used to manage data. As a Microsoft SQL Server DBA , we raised a support ticket to Microsoft support team for a major bug in non clustered column store index in 2016 version SP2 due to our internal security policies restrictions we are unable to bring the support team to diagnose our server. 4 Prior to SQL Server 2019 PolyBase head node requires Enterprise edition. There are many other differences though, some of which can be extremely important for some application and . Yeah theyve complicated the matter by not marking anything as an SP anymore, which is another reason I try to avoid whatever the current version is so long as the version Im using is still supported. Use the information in the following tables to determine the set of features that best fits your needs. SQL Server 2016: 130: SQL Server 2017: 140: SQL Server 2019: 150: Table 1: SQL Server Versions and Native Compatibility Levels. Created Linked Servers between SQL Server 2008 & 2008 R2, also created a DTS package for data transfer between the two environments. For more information, see Install SQL Server. 1. But my ERP vendor says: with that version of this ERP system youre allowed to just use 2008 R2, 2012 or 2014. For more information, see Compute capacity limits by edition of SQL Server. We are currently happily on 2012, just dont want to get too antiquated. Really great! . It generates all the reports and allows you to focus on where needs to be improved. Actually I believe that the way Microsoft is releasing SQL servers every one or two years like service packs will cost them heavily to maintain the code base and the team developing them. In this version, Microsoft wanted to sort out the OLTP problems. The server can run with Windows, Linux, and containers and has support for deployment on Kubernetes. It is important to note that licenses are generally purchased with the purchase of a server. Windows Server 2016 Identity and similar courses helped to make people fluent in this server. In 2016, updateable non-clustered indexes were introduced. 8*25GB > 100GB and BOOM! This allows you to have a single primary and single replica database. I havent found a case yet where folks could deal with the limitations and the lack of guarantees around restore time, but I would be totally okay with it if they could. 2017 RTM was a great example of Change is inevitable change for the better is not. For example, if SQL Server 2016 RTM is supported on Windows 10, this implies that any CUs on top of SQL Server 2016 RTM or SQL Server 2016 Service Pack 1 (SP1) are supported on Windows 10.Summary. I suppose it is too much to ask that it smells like bacon. Thank you for the warning. I update the post every release Ive already updated it since it was originally posted. Thanks for the pointers! Cardinality estimation is one of the major problem. I have found out that there's two versions of SQL Server types that are very different in terms of pricing. Thats a little beyond what I can do quickly in a blog post comment. As such, you can query data stored in Oracle, Teradata, HDFS or any other sources. Im running 2017 on my dev environment and a few queries using dynamic SQL are way slower than before (like 20s rather than 3s) because of changes to the cardinality estimator. Several DDL and DML commands were added such as null values, foreign keys, and DML triggers. While rebuilding indexes is quite a daunting engagement, most database management systems do not allow for offline maintenance. As of late 2022, SQL Server 2019 has the biggest installation base, and its growing like wildfire. Moreover, you can enhance your high-value data by combining it with big data and the ability to dynamically scale out compute to support analytics. Privacy Policy Terms and Conditions, sp_BlitzFirst instant performance check. Recent SQL server versions are not stable, thats why Microsoft keep releasing multiple SQL server version every year. SQL Server 2016 has both deprecated and discontinued features. Get to know the features and benefits now available in SQL Server 2019. Call us Today on, Compare Different Versions of SQL Server-2014 vs. 2016 vs. 2017 vs. 2019 RC, 1591 McKenzie Way, Point Roberts, WA 98281, United States. SQL Server Data Tools provides an IDE for building solutions for the Business Intelligence components: Analysis Services, Reporting Services, and Integration Services. If you are using an older version then there might be differences to watch out for. This a very well thought out post! We are looking for a document that shows the comparison between SQL Server 2014 and SQL Server 2016, for example performance, functionality, pros and cons of each other, that kind of material would be great and would be better if it is documented in an official or non-official document. We receive SQL backups from them and restore to a SQL Server 2016 in our data center, which would mean we need to upgrade our servers to 2019 as well. Matt yeah, generally I prefer virtualization for that scenario. The only way to recover that space is to rebuild the related heap or index. 2008-2017 can all coexist on a 2012 R2 Windows Server, but SQL 2019 will require at least Windows 2016, which means SQL 2008 and 2008 R2 have to drop off. I teach SQL Server training classes, or if you havent got time for the pain, Im available for consulting too. Therefore Im stuck with 2014. Most parts of SQL Server get minor changes at best, but SSAS Tabular 2017 gets a host of major improvements. Install media is a standalone tool that can be downloaded individually from Microsoft. 1 Basic integration is limited to 2 cores and in-memory data sets. The different editions of SQL Server accommodate the unique performance, runtime, and price requirements of organizations and individuals. Youre dealing with an application whose newest supported version is only SQL Server 2014, but not 2016 or newer. But this new version of SQL Server supports free asynchronous replication on Azure Virtual Machines for disaster recovery. If you were using SSAS Tabular a lot, Id say to go for 2017 instead of 2016. Im based out of Las Vegas. "40" and "twice" are assuming HT is enabled; if not, half those figures. Reading Time: 4 minutes. Hi, seeing as nobody appears to have asked for a few months, now that were in 2021 Im curious as to whether you still feel the same about preferring SQL Server 2017 over SQL Server 2019 in most use cases, or has 2019 finally matured enough? Thanks! Currently on SQL 2014 and can get business support to test every 3 years at the most. 2014 was skipped because we did not found strong reasons to update. Windows Server 2016 was the fastest server ever produced by Microsoft when launched. In the SQL Server 2019 version, a new feature for cloud readiness is added. Apps are fairly stable and they make high use of UDFs and table variables. After reading the post and all comments, I am getting the impression that upgrading just to be up-to-date isnt viewed favorably in the DB community?
Jack Lambert Website, Predicting The Consequences Of An Action In Autism, Jimmy White Obituary Rogersville, Al, Articles D